Walkovers send Nadal and Novak into final

Rafael Nadal and Novak Djokovic reached the final of the Miami ATP Masters yesterday morning (Singapore time), after their semi-final opponents Tomas Berdych and Kei Nishikori withdrew.

The two semi-final walkovers were a first in ATP history, with Nishikori pulling out with a groin injury and Berdych felled by gastroenteritis.

Berdych, who received IV fluids in a futile attempt to be ready for his evening match against Nadal, was at a loss to explain how he became so ill.

"I woke up at 7.30 in th`e morning with pain in my stomach. I am disappointed about not getting a chance to play," he said.

Nishikori withdrew after attempting to warm up for his earlier match against Djokovic, saying the left groin injury hindered his movement too much to allow him to play.

The injury ended Nishikori's sparkling run where he beat world No. 5 David Ferrer in the fourth round and then Swiss great Roger Federer in the quarter-finals.
